BurpSuite深度解析:攻防一体的Web应用测试平台
9 浏览量
更新于2024-07-15
收藏 1.8MB PDF 举报
BurpSuite是一款专为Web应用程序安全评估而设计的强大集成平台,它集合了多种工具,旨在提升攻击应用程序的效率。这个平台的核心特点是其共享的可扩展框架,能够处理和显示HTTP消息、认证、代理、日志和警报。以下是BurpSuite的主要组件及其功能概述:
1. Target(目标):此功能展示了目标应用程序的目录结构,帮助用户了解网站的结构,便于定位测试区域。
2. Proxy(代理):作为浏览器与应用程序之间的中间代理,它允许用户拦截、查看和修改HTTP/S流量,提供对数据流的全面控制,这对于发现和利用漏洞至关重要。
3. Spider(蜘蛛):这是一种智能网络爬虫,能够自动探测和枚举应用程序的内容和功能,有助于全面扫描网站的可达性和可能存在的漏洞。
4. Scanner(扫描器):高级扫描器执行后,能自动检测出Web应用中的安全漏洞,减轻手动检查的负担。
5. Intruder(入侵):定制化且高度可配置的工具,用于对应用进行自动化攻击,包括枚举标识符、数据收集和Fuzzing(模糊测试)来寻找常规漏洞。
6. Repeater(中继器):手动操作工具,用于逐个触发HTTP请求,观察和分析应用程序的响应,适合处理交互式或复杂的场景。
7. Sequencer(会话):解析和分析不可预测的会话令牌和关键数据,确保安全测试的准确性。
8. Decoder(解码器):工具用于手动或智能地解码和编码应用程序数据,帮助理解隐藏的信息。
9. Comparer(对比):通过可视化方式展示相关请求和响应之间的差异,便于发现潜在问题。
10. Extender(扩展):允许用户扩展BurpSuite的功能,通过加载自定义或第三方插件,增加工具的灵活性和定制性。
11. Options(设置):提供了丰富的配置选项,允许用户根据实际需求调整BurpSuite的工作模式和参数。
BurpSuite支持的手动测试工作流程结合了手动探索和自动化工具,允许用户在浏览器中进行操作,同时监控和分析抓取的数据。在测试过程中,Proxy工具扮演了核心角色,尤其是在侦察和分析阶段,它协助用户识别和分析潜在漏洞,优化测试策略。
BurpSuite是一个强大且灵活的平台,适用于Web安全专业人士进行深度和广泛的测试,无论是针对小型项目还是大型企业应用,都能提供全面且高效的工具支持。
2014-11-11 上传
2022-06-09 上传
2024-03-10 上传
2020-12-24 上传
2018-07-19 上传
2023-07-27 上传
2018-08-06 上传
2015-10-26 上传
2022-12-28 上传
weixin_38523728
- 粉丝: 3
- 资源: 973
最新资源
- 深入浅出:自定义 Grunt 任务的实践指南
- 网络物理突变工具的多点路径规划实现与分析
- multifeed: 实现多作者间的超核心共享与同步技术
- C++商品交易系统实习项目详细要求
- macOS系统Python模块whl包安装教程
- 掌握fullstackJS:构建React框架与快速开发应用
- React-Purify: 实现React组件纯净方法的工具介绍
- deck.js:构建现代HTML演示的JavaScript库
- nunn:现代C++17实现的机器学习库开源项目
- Python安装包 Acquisition-4.12-cp35-cp35m-win_amd64.whl.zip 使用说明
- Amaranthus-tuberculatus基因组分析脚本集
- Ubuntu 12.04下Realtek RTL8821AE驱动的向后移植指南
- 掌握Jest环境下的最新jsdom功能
- CAGI Toolkit:开源Asterisk PBX的AGI应用开发
- MyDropDemo: 体验QGraphicsView的拖放功能
- 远程FPGA平台上的Quartus II17.1 LCD色块闪烁现象解析